Abstract
The utility model relates to a teaching aid, especially relates to a device for comparing sound-transmitting capabilities of subjects and aims to solve the problem that it is difficult to distinguish the sound-transmitting capabilities of the subjects by human ears in the prior art. The device for comparing the sound-transmitting capabilities of the subjects includes a sounding unit and a sound-receiving unit. The sounding unit includes an electronic sounding apparatus and a sounding diaphragm which is connected to the electronic sounding apparatus. The sound-receiving unit includes an earphone and a pickup diaphragm. A sound sounded by the electronic sounding apparatus is spread in a subject. The sounds heard from the earphone are different in volume in the situation that the subjects to be tested in different materials are equal in lengths so that sound-transmitting capabilities in different subjects can be very easily distinguished. The device is simple in structure, is easy to manufacture, is low in cost and is convenient to operate.

Background technology
As everyone knows, different objects is different to the transmission capacity of sound, i.e. the extent of deterioration difference of sound in different objects.But in teaching, especially on classroom, the transaudient ability of method comparison different objects is by experiment difficult to.In existing school science teaching material also layout the related content of different objects sound transmission ability, and design a grouping experiment, use tuning fork sounding, people's ear listens the method for distinguishing to compare the transaudient ability of 1 meter of long wooden rule, aluminium foil, cotton thread, nylon wire, and poor effect and comparability are not strong.

Embodiment
Consult Fig. 1, a kind of relatively device of the transaudient ability of object, comprises pronunciation unit and radio reception unit; The pronunciation vibrating diaphragm 1 that described pronunciation unit comprises electronic sound generator 3, is connected by wire with electronic sound generator 3; The pickup vibrating diaphragm 2 that described radio reception unit comprises earphone 5, is connected with earphone 5; Described radio reception unit also comprises loudspeaker 4, and described pickup vibrating diaphragm 2 is connected with loudspeaker 4 by wire, and described earphone 5 is arranged on loudspeaker 4.
When use, the material of needs comparison is measured, pronunciation vibrating diaphragm 1 and pickup vibrating diaphragm 2 are placed on respectively on same object, make vibrating diaphragm 1 and pickup vibrating diaphragm 2 to maintain a certain distance, then put on earphone 5, open electronic sound generator 3; Then other material is carried out to identical step, pronunciation vibrating diaphragm 1 is identical all the time in the different blanking time intervals of measurement with pickup vibrating diaphragm 2, then sound size is compared, and can determine the size of different materials to sound transmission ability; Tested object can be solid, can be also liquids and gases.
